About this Visa

This visa lets companies move employees from outside Europe to Belgium temporarily. It's for managers, specialists, and trainees working for multinational companies. You get a work permit and residence card combined in one. This visa is special because you don't need a job interview or labor test. Your company sponsors you. You can bring your family and they can work too.

Eligibility & Requirements

Eligibility Criteria

  • Must be 18 or older
  • Must have worked for your company 3-6 months before transfer (depending on region)
  • Need a bachelor's degree for manager/specialist jobs (some IT exceptions in certain regions)
  • Must earn the minimum salary for your position
  • Cannot have a serious criminal record
  • Must have a job offer from a Belgian company in the same corporate group
  • Must have worked the same position or higher in your home country

Financial Requirement

You must earn a minimum salary depending on your job: Manager €5,460/month, Specialist €4,511/month, Trainee €2,611/month. These amounts are for Brussels and change yearly. Other regions have different amounts.

Documents

  • Valid passportRequired for all applicants
  • Employment contractShowing job title and salary
  • Education diplomaBachelor's degree minimum
  • Pay stubsLast 3 months of pay stubs
  • Corporate documentsProving company is part of larger group
  • Employment historyProof you worked for your original company for 3-6 months
  • Health insurance paperworkProof of health coverage
  • Medical certificateShowing no infectious diseases
  • Criminal record certificateFrom your country of origin
  • FBI criminal recordIf you're American, dated within 6 months
  • Application fee receiptProof of payment
